# Spring Ecosystem 2026: The Pinnacle of Native, Reactive, Secure, and High-Concurrency Microservices — Updated and Expanded
The Spring ecosystem in 2026 exemplifies a decade of relentless innovation, strategic evolution, and unwavering commitment to empowering modern enterprise Java development. Building upon foundational principles and recent breakthroughs, this year marks a transformative era driven by native execution, reactive paradigms, fortified security, and unprecedented concurrency support. These advancements enable organizations worldwide to craft **fast, scalable, resilient microservices** tailored for today’s digital economy, while also embracing AI-driven capabilities, sophisticated observability tools, and scalable integration strategies for legacy systems.
This comprehensive update synthesizes the latest developments—spanning major releases, migration strategies, performance benchmarks, new tooling, and emerging AI integrations—offering an authoritative view of Spring’s trajectory and its pivotal role in shaping enterprise software in 2026.
---
## Major Architectural Milestones: Spring Boot 4.x & Spring Framework 7
In early 2026, the simultaneous release of **Spring Boot 4.x** and **Spring Framework 7** heralded a **paradigm shift** in enterprise Java development:
- **Native Image Support via GraalVM & AOT (Ahead-Of-Time) Compilation:**
Applications can now be **compiled into native images**, leading to **startup times measured in milliseconds**—a critical benefit for serverless functions, edge computing, and cost-sensitive cloud deployments. This capability enables **instantaneous scaling**, dramatically reducing operational costs and response latency.
- **Enhanced AOT & Native Compatibility APIs:**
Spring Framework 7 introduces **native-friendly APIs** explicitly designed for **AOT workflows** and **native image generation**. These APIs facilitate **seamless integration** with container-native ecosystems and simplify **migration from legacy architectures**, making native deployment more accessible.
- **Reactive-First Web Framework & Project Reactor:**
Transitioning **Spring WebFlux** into the **default web framework**, the ecosystem now fully embraces a **reactive, non-blocking, event-driven architecture**. Microservices built on these paradigms handle **massive concurrency** with **high throughput** and **low latency**, even under peak loads, leading to **greater resilience** and **fault tolerance**.
- **API Modernization for Native Compatibility:**
All major APIs across the ecosystem have been **optimized for native image generation** and **AOT workflows**, resulting in **more predictable performance** and **streamlined deployment pipelines**.
### The Concurrency Revolution: Virtual Threads and Beyond
A hallmark of 2026 is the **deep integration of Project Loom's virtual threads** into Spring’s concurrency model:
- **Unparalleled Concurrency Support:**
Virtual threads enable **thousands of lightweight, concurrent tasks** with **minimal resource overhead**, dramatically **boosting throughput** and **reducing latency**. This is especially impactful for **high-demand, data-heavy microservices** operating at scale.
- **Simplified Programming Model:**
Developers can **write code in a synchronous style**, which **executes asynchronously** under the hood, **minimizing bugs** tied to traditional thread management and **improving developer productivity**.
- **Empirical Validation & Industry Adoption:**
Benchmarks from tools like **k6** and numerous case studies confirm **significant resource efficiency improvements**. As a result, Spring-based microservices are **more resilient**, **cost-effective**, and **scalable at enterprise levels**.
---
## Navigating the Migration: Strategies for Seamless Transition
As organizations adopt these cutting-edge features, **migration strategies** are essential to **minimize disruption** and **maximize benefits**:
- **Incremental Module Upgrades:**
Validate and upgrade each component independently, phasing updates gradually to **prevent regressions** and **maintain system stability**.
- **Leverage Gradle 9.3:**
The **latest Gradle 9.3** release enhances **native/AOT support**, **faster build times**, and **dependency management**, critical for **large-scale native and AOT workflows**.
- **Dependency Compatibility Checks:**
Employ **community tools** and **dependency scanners** to verify third-party library compatibility, preventing **runtime issues** post-migration.
- **Embedding Native & AOT in CI/CD Pipelines:**
Automate **native image creation** and **AOT workflows** within **CI/CD pipelines** to ensure **reliable, repeatable deployments** and **rapid iteration cycles**.
- **Proactive Testing & Benchmarking:**
Continuously perform **performance tests**, **security scans**, and **integration validation** to **maintain system stability** and **security integrity**.
### Addressing Build Challenges
Migration may surface common issues such as **Gradle output-to-source violations**, exemplified by:
> **"Cannot access output property 'outputDir' of task ':openApiGenerate'"**
Countermeasures include **validating build scripts**, **checking plugin compatibility**, and **consulting community tutorials**—steps that streamline migration and prevent build failures.
---
## Developer-Centric Innovations: APIs, Concurrency, and Security
### Transition from RestTemplate to WebClient
By 2026, **RestTemplate** has been **officially deprecated**, with **WebClient** now the **standard** for HTTP communication:
- Supports **reactive, non-blocking operations**, including **streaming**, **WebSocket**, and **custom protocols**.
- Facilitates **scalable**, **resource-efficient** inter-service communication.
- Community resources like **"Stop Using RestTemplate! Modern Microservices Communication in Spring Boot Explained"** provide comprehensive **migration guidance**.
### Virtual Threads & Simplified Concurrency
The adoption of **virtual threads** has **revolutionized concurrent programming**:
- Enables **synchronous-looking code** that **executes asynchronously**.
- **Reduces bugs** and **debugging complexity**.
- Industry data confirms **resource savings** and **throughput enhancements**, supporting **more scalable** and **cost-efficient systems**.
### Fortified Security Practices
**Spring Security 7**, released in late 2025, continues to **set industry standards**:
- **Simplified configuration** accelerates **secure development**.
- Supports **OAuth2**, **JWT**, and **SSO**, streamlining **API security**.
- **Multi-Factor Authentication (MFA)** is now **industry standard**, strengthening **enterprise security posture**.
- Ecosystem tools like **Snyk** and **OWASP Dependency-Track** assist with **vulnerability detection** and **dependency management**.
- Techniques such as **"Spoof-Proof File Type Validation in Spring Boot Using Apache Tika"** bolster **content security**, thwarting **content spoofing** and **malicious uploads**.
### Resiliency & Event-Driven Patterns
Integrating **Resilience4j** enhances **fault tolerance** with **circuit breakers**, **fallbacks**, and **retry policies**. Compatibility with **Apache Kafka**, **gRPC**, **RabbitMQ**, and **Spring Cloud Gateway** supports **high-throughput**, **low-latency** communication, with features like **dynamic routing** and **security enforcement**.
Support for **GraphQL** and **gRPC** further broadens **data fetching** and **inter-service communication**, accompanied by **comprehensive tutorials** and **sample projects**.
---
## Ecosystem & Tooling: Supporting a Future-Ready Developer
The Spring ecosystem continues its robust expansion, emphasizing **observability**, **documentation**, and **community engagement**:
- Built-in **metrics**, **distributed tracing**, and **dashboards** enable comprehensive **system monitoring**.
- **springdoc OpenAPI** automates **API documentation**, **versioning**, and **security schemas**.
- Resources like the **"Kafka Ecosystem Masterclass"** (27-minute training) cover **event-driven architecture**, **Kafka scaling**, and **best practices**.
### Emerging Techniques & AI Integration
Recent innovations include **"🚀 Ultra-Fast Pagination in Spring Boot | Production-Ready Keyset"**, demonstrating **performance optimizations** like **keyset pagination**, which significantly **reduces database load** and **response latency**, especially in **native** and **virtual-threaded environments**.
Furthermore, **Spring AI** initiatives are actively fostering **AI-native architectures**, with resources such as:
- **"Spring AI 实战:手把手教你构建智能对话助手(支持流式输出)"** — a Chinese-language tutorial on **building intelligent chatbots** with **streaming support**.
- **"Shipping a Feature with AI — A Disciplined Agent Workflow Demo"** — a **22-minute** video demonstrating **AI-driven feature development**.
- Integration tutorials with **Azure OpenAI Service** guide developers in **connecting Spring Boot applications** with **GPT-4, GPT-4 Turbo, DALL-E, and Whisper**, enabling **enterprise-grade AI features**.
These initiatives are part of a broader **AI-native movement**, where **reactive**, **native**, **concurrent**, and **AI** components are intertwined to create **intelligent, adaptive microservices**.
---
## Architectural Perspectives: Modular Monoliths vs. Microservices
While **native microservices architectures** dominate, **modular monoliths** remain relevant—especially for organizations favoring **gradual evolution**:
- **Advantages include:** **simpler deployment**, **low latency**, and **incremental migration paths**.
- **Key principles** such as **bounded contexts** and **domain-driven design** underpin successful transitions.
Discussions like **"Modular Monoliths and Other Facepalm Moments"** (Kevlin Henney, NDC London 2026) highlight the importance of **strategic architecture choices** aligned with organizational needs.
---
## Exposing Legacy MCP Systems for Modern Use
A significant new development in 2026 is the focus on **exposing MCP (Mainframe Control Protocol)** from legacy Java systems to modern Spring-native architectures:
> **"Exposing MCP from Legacy Java: Scalable Architectures"**
> This practical architecture guide details how to **integrate and expose MCP protocols** from legacy Jakarta EE or mainframe systems, enabling **scalable, secure, and reactive access** via Spring Boot microservices.
> Key strategies include **protocol translation**, **gateway orchestration**, and **event-driven data streaming**, supporting **gradual migration** and **hybrid architectures** that leverage existing investments while harnessing modern capabilities.
This approach offers **scalable migration pathways**, allowing organizations to **incrementally modernize** without sacrificing **legacy stability**.
---
## Highlights from the "Spring Forward" Event
The community-driven **"Spring Forward"** conference showcased a wealth of **cutting-edge demos**:
- **Migration workshops** covered **native image optimization**, **reactive adoption**, and **security enhancements**.
- A standout session on **"Passwordless Login in Spring Boot"** demonstrated **passwordless authentication** with **one-time tokens**, reflecting **industry trends** toward **user-friendly, secure login**.
- The **Kafka Masterclass** provided **hands-on training** in **event-driven architecture** and **Kafka scaling**, reinforcing **enterprise readiness**.
---
## Supporting Production-Grade Kafka & Native Libraries
The resource **"Day 10: Production-Grade Dependency Management for Kafka Streams with Native Libraries"** offers vital guidance:
- Achieving **high throughput**, **low latency**, and **fault tolerance**.
- Leveraging **native libraries** for **resource efficiency**, especially critical for **large-scale enterprise deployments**.
This approach enhances **streaming capabilities**, positioning Kafka as a **cornerstone** of resilient, event-driven microservices.
---
## Current Status & Future Implications
As of 2026, **Spring** exemplifies a **resilient, high-performance platform** capable of addressing **enterprise complexities**:
- **Milliseconds startup times** facilitate **dynamic scaling** and **cost-effective cloud operations**.
- **Virtual threads** support **massive concurrency** with **resource efficiency**.
- **Fortified security protocols**, **timely vulnerability detection**, and **content validation** bolster **enterprise resilience**.
- **Developer experience** benefits from **streamlined APIs**, **automated workflows**, and **powerful tooling**, significantly **reducing time-to-market** and **operational costs**.
- **Architectural agility**, driven by **resiliency patterns**, **event-driven messaging**, and **protocol support**, enables organizations to **respond swiftly** to market shifts.
**In essence**, Spring 2026 offers an **integrated, future-proof platform**—empowering enterprises to **innovate confidently** amidst rapid technological evolution.
---
## Embracing the Future: Pathways Forward
The ecosystem’s ongoing evolution underscores **AI-native architectures** and **automated intelligent workflows**. Initiatives like **Spring AI** are pioneering **next-generation microservices** that **seamlessly integrate AI models** within **reactive**, **native**, and **high-concurrency** environments. Notable developments include:
- Building **Retrieval-Augmented Generation (RAG) chatbots** with Spring Boot + **Large Language Models (LLMs)**.
- Developing **production-ready AI features** leveraging **Azure OpenAI** or **local models** like Ollama & Pinecone for **vector similarity search**—enabling **privacy-conscious, offline AI solutions**.
- Automating **content validation**, **security**, and **performance optimization** through **AI-driven insights**.
**Recommendations for organizations**:
- Adopt **incremental migration strategies** supported by **comprehensive testing**.
- Embed **native image** and **AOT workflows** into **CI/CD pipelines** for **reliable, rapid deployment**.
- Leverage **community resources**, tutorials, and **sample projects**—such as the **Kafka Masterclass** and **AI integration guides**—to **accelerate adoption**.
- Prioritize **security best practices** and **content validation techniques** to **maintain enterprise resilience**.
By following these pathways, organizations can **confidently step into the future of Java microservices**, leveraging Spring’s full potential.
---
## Final Reflection: Spring 2026—A Platform for Infinite Possibilities
The **Spring ecosystem in 2026** exemplifies a **harmonious fusion of innovation and stability**. Its support for **native images**, **reactive programming**, **virtual threads**, **AI-native architectures**, and **industry-leading security** makes it the **cornerstone for building tomorrow’s resilient, high-performance microservices**.
**The message is clear**: the future is **native**, **reactive**, **secure**, and **AI-enabled**. Spring isn’t merely evolving—it’s actively **shaping** this future.
**Spring into 2026**—where **speed**, **security**, and **scalability** converge to redefine enterprise excellence.
---
## Summary of Key Points
- **Architectural Innovations:** Spring Boot 4.x & Spring Framework 7 introduce **native image support**, **AOT**, **reactive-first design**, and **virtual threads**.
- **Migration & Tooling:** Use **Gradle 9.3**, automate **native/AOT workflows** within **CI/CD**, verify **dependency compatibility**, and address build challenges proactively.
- **Developer Practices:** Transition from **RestTemplate** to **WebClient/RestClient**, adopt **virtual threads**, and implement **Spring Security 7** best practices.
- **Performance & Benchmarks:** Recent **Spring Boot 4.0.2** benchmarks highlight **performance gains** across web, reactive, CDS, AOT, and native deployments; **WebFlux** demonstrates superior scalability for reactive workloads.
- **Ecosystem & Resources:** Leverage **native Kafka libraries**, **Spring AI**, and **advanced observability tools**.
- **Best Practices & Recommendations:** Emphasize **incremental migration**, **automated native/AOT workflows**, **security vigilance**, and **community engagement**.
**In conclusion**, Spring 2026 is not just a platform—it's a **comprehensive ecosystem** enabling enterprises to **innovate confidently**, **scale efficiently**, and **securely** meet the challenges of the future.
---
## Additional Noteworthy Articles
### How a Request Flows in Spring Boot Microservices using Kafka with Load Balancing and Tracing
> **"Explain how a request flows in Spring Boot Microservices using Kafka with Load Balancing and Tracing"**
> An in-depth explainer, available as a 1:27 YouTube video, illustrates the **end-to-end request flow** in Kafka-backed microservices, emphasizing how **load balancing**, **distributed tracing**, and **event streaming** work together to deliver **highly scalable**, **observability-rich** architectures.
### Resolving Spring Boot Exception: The Elements Were Left Unbound
> **"Resolving Spring Boot Exception: The Elements Were Left Unbound"**
> This tutorial offers guidance on **common configuration binding issues**, explaining **causes**, **detection**, and **best practices** for **validation**—crucial for **maintaining stability** during complex migrations.
---
## Final Note
As Spring continues its evolution into a **native, reactive, AI-enabled**, and **highly secure** platform, organizations equipped with **modern migration strategies**, **robust tooling**, and **cutting-edge practices** will be best positioned to **lead in the digital age**. The journey into 2026 and beyond is marked by **opportunity**—embrace it with confidence.
**Update Outline**: 1) Spring Boot 4.x & Spring Framework 7: native/AOT, reactive-first, virtual threads; 2) Migration strategies: incremental upgrades, Gradle 9.3, CI/CD native/AOT, dependency checks, common build issues; 3) Developer practices: WebClient/RestClient, virtual threads, Spring Security 7, Resilience4j patterns; 4) Ecosystem & tooling: observability, springdoc OpenAPI, Kafka native libs, Spring AI and AI integrations; 5) Performance & optimizations: Spring MVC optimizations, adaptive timeouts for outbound calls, keyset pagination, production-grade Kafka streams; 6) Legacy integration: exposing MCP and protocol translation; 7) Recommendations: incremental migration, automated workflows, security vigilance, community resources.
**New Articles Added** (full content):
[
{
"title": "Optimizations in Spring MVC",
"content": "Title: Optimizations in Spring MVC\n\nContent: The application code is taken from some public benchmarks. The data represent fruits with links to the stores that stock them and the prices listed. The /f"
},
{
"title": "Spring Boot Interview - Adaptive Timeouts for Outbound Call",
"content": "Title: Spring Boot Interview - Adaptive Timeouts for Outbound Call\n\nContent: You are building a Spring Boot microservice that calls multiple external services over HTTP (e.g., payment gateways, third-"
}
]
**Removed Articles** (titles only):
None
**Task**:
Write a comprehensive markdown article that:
1. Builds upon the previous context with new developments
2. Synthesizes the key information into a coherent narrative
3. Covers the main events, developments, and their significance
4. Highlights important details, quotes, and data points
5. Uses clear structure with paragraphs, **bold** for emphasis, and bullet points where appropriate
6. Is comprehensive but not redundant - avoid repeating the same information
**Format**:
- Start with a strong opening that captures the essence of the topic
- Organize information logically (chronologically or by importance)
- Include specific details and examples from the articles
- End with current status or implications if relevant
Output the markdown article directly (no JSON wrapper, no title header).